Use std::hypot() instead of sqrt() of a sum of squares.
This ensures length() can't be zero when isNull() is false.
Use length() in QLine::setLength() rather than duplicating that.
Clarify and expand some documentation; isNull() never said what
constituted validity, nor did unitVector() mention that is should not
be used on a line for which isNull() is true. Make clear that lines of
denormal length cannot be rescaled accurately.
Given that we use fuzzy comparison to determine equality of
end-points, isNull() can be false for a line with displacements less
than sqrt(numeric_limits<qreal>::denorm_min()) between the coordinates
of its end-points (as long as these are not much bigger); squaring
these would give zero, hence a zero length, where using hypot() avoids
the underflow and gives a non-zero length. Having a zero length for a
line with isNull() false would lead to problems in setLength(), which
uses an isNull() pre-test, protecting a call to unitVector().
(It was already possible for a null line to have non-zero length; this
now arises in more cases.)
Restored QLine::setLength() to the form it had before a recent change
to avoid division by zero (which resulted from underflow in computing
the length of a non-null line) but allow for the possibility that the
unit vector it computes as transient may not have length exactly one.
Add tests against {ov,und}erflow problems in QLine. Reworked the test
added during the divide-by-zero fix to make it part of the existing
test.

Current implementation of QLineEdit uses the "edited" bit-field flag to
prevent unnecessary emissions of editingFinished() when a line edit
loses focus but its contents have not changed since the last time the
signal was emitted; however, this flag is only cleared when the signal
is fired due to focus loss and not when the Return/Enter key is pressed.
This causes an unexpected double emission of the signal when focus is
lost following a press of the Return/Enter key if the line edit's text
was not further altered between the two actions.
This change includes the Return/Enter press as a trigger for clearing
the "edited" flag to make editingFinished()'s behavior more consistent
and expected. Prevents slots in user code from triggering twice in
situations where the line edit's current contents have already been
handled, but still allows the end-user to force an emission of the
signal via Return/Enter.
The effect of the "edited" flag on the signals behavior has also been
noted in the signal description as it was previously omitted.
[ChangeLog][QtWidgets][QLineEdit][Behavior Change] Pressing the
Return/Enter key in a QLineEdit will now also prevent editingFinished()
from firing due to focus loss if the contents of the line edit have not
changed since the last time the signal was emitted.

Current implementation of QProgressDialog always calls
QCoreApplication::processEvents() when the user calls
QProgressDialog::setValue() if the PD is modal. For most cases this is
fine, but when using a Qt::WindowModal PD with setValue() connected to
a signal in another thread using Qt::QueuedConnection a reentrancy
issue is present if setValue() is triggered too frequently as the
execution of its previous call may not have finished. If this happens
too many times in a row a stack overflow will occur.
Current documentation notes this potential issue but offers no way it
avoid it while still using QProgressDialog (user must implement a
custom dialog) without resorting to using Qt::BlockingQueuedConnection,
which unnecessarily reduces performance.
Introduces the boolean reentrancy guard "processingEvents" that is
checked before calling QCoreApplication::processEvents() in a modal
PD when setValue() is used. It is set before the first call to
processEvents() and cleared after that call returns. This ensures that
only one invocation of processEvents() is possible from within
setValue() at a time, and thereby minimizes iterations of the main event
loop and eliminates the aforementioned stack overflow condition.

For HTTP connections, QNAM defaults to opening its TCP socket in
unbuffered mode. This means that Qt will send the data written
into the socket right to the kernel, queueing only if the kernel
says it doesn't want more data for the moment being.
QNAM itself then uses separate write() calls to write the HTTP
headers and the body of the request (like POST or PUT). These 2+
writes result in headers and body being sent over different TCP
segments -- even if, in principle, a POST with a few bytes of data
(e.g. a HTML form, or a REST or SOAP request) could fit in the same
segment as the request.
Multiple writes like this interact extremely poorly with other
TCP features, e.g. delayed ACKs, Nagle's algorithm and the like.
In a typical scenario, the kernel will send a segment containing just
the headers, wait for the ACK (which may be delayed), and only then
send the body (it wasn't sent before because Nagle was blocking it).
The reply at this point is immediate (because the server can process
the request and starts replying), but the delayed ACK is typically
40-50ms, and documented up to 500ms (!). If one uses QNAM to access a
service, this introduces unacceptable latency.
These multiple writes to the OS should be avoided.
The first thing that comes into mind is to use buffered sockets.
Now, there are good reasons to keep the socket unbuffered, so we
don't want to change that. But the deal breaker is that even buffered
sockets won't help in general: for instance, on Windows, a buffered
write will immediately detect that the socket is ready for write and
flush the buffer right away (not 100% sure of why this is necessary;
basically, after populating the QTcpSocket write buffer, Qt enables
a write socket notifier on the socket -- notifier that fires
synchronously and immediately, without even returning to the event
loop, and that causes the write buffer flush).
Linux of course offers the perfect solution: corking the socket via
TCP_CORK, which tells the kernel not to send the data right away but
to buffer it up to a timeout (or when the option gets disabled
again, whichever comes first). It's explicitly designed to support
the case of sending headers followed by something like a
sendfile(2). Setting this socket option moves the problem to
the kernel and we could happily keep issuing multiple writes.
Ça va sans dire, no other OS supports that option or any other
similar option.
We have therefore to deal with this in userspace: don't write in the
socket multiple times, but try and coalesce the write of the headers
with the writing of the data. This patch implements that, by storing
the headers and sending them together with the very first chunk of
data. If the data is small enough, this sends the entire request
in one TCP segment.
Interestingly enough, QNAM has a call setting TCP_NODELAY
currently commented out because Qt doesn't combine "HTTP requests"
(whatever that means). The call comes all the way back
from pre-public history (before 2011) (!). This patch doesn't
touch it.

Because of these lines in the Linux kernel (kernel/fork.c, see [1][3]):
if (clone_flags & CLONE_VFORK)
trace = PTRACE_EVENT_VFORK;
else if (args->exit_signal != SIGCHLD)
trace = PTRACE_EVENT_CLONE;
else
trace = PTRACE_EVENT_FORK;
Without CLONE_VFORK (which we can't use), if the exit signal isn't
SIGCHLD, the debugger will get a PTRACE_EVENT_CLONE, which makes it
think the process we're starting is a thread, not a new process. Both
gdb and lldb remain attached to the child and when it later performs an
execve(), they get mightily confused. See gdb bug report[5].
The idea of not having an exit_signal was so that no SIGCHLD would be
delivered to the parent process in the first place. That way, some
misguided SIGCHLD handler (*cough* GLib *cough*) wouldn't reap our
processes. Unfortunately, what I didn't realize was that the kernel
sends SIGCHLD anyway (see [2][4]), so this defensive measure didn't
actually work. Consequently, we can pass SIGCHLD to clone() and get the
debuggers working again.
[ChangeLog][Linux] Fixed an issue that would cause debugging a Qt
application that uses QProcess to confuse both gdb and lldb if
the Linux kernel was version 5.4 or higher. Behavior outside of
a debugging session was not affected.

QQuickEventPoint instances were very long-lived and got reused from one
event to the next. That was initially done because they were "heavy"
QObjects; but it also became useful to store state in them between
events. But this is in conflict with the ubiquitous event replay
code that assumes it's OK to hold an event instance (especially
a QMouseEvent) for any length of time, and then send it to some widget,
item or window. Clearly QEventPoints must be stored in the QPointerEvent,
if we are to avoid the need for workarounds to keep such old code working.
And now they have d-pointers, so copying is cheap. But replay code
will need to detach() their QEventPoints now.
QEventPoint is useful as an object to hold state, but we now store
the truly persistent state separately in an EventPointData struct,
in QPointingDevicePrivate::activePoints. Incoming events merely
update the persistent points, then we deliver those instead.
Thus when event handler code modifies state, it will be remembered
even when the delivery is done and the QPA event is destroyed.
This gets us a step closer to supporting multiple simultaneous mice.
Within pointer events, the points are moved up to QPointerEvent itself:
QList<QEventPoint> m_points;
This means pointCount(), point(int i) and points() can be non-virtual.
However in any QSinglePointEvent, the list only contains one point.
We hope that pessimization is worthwhile for the sake of removing
virtual functions, simplifying code in event classes themselves, and
enabling the use of the range-for loop over points() with any kind of
QPointerEvent, not just QTouchEvent. points() is a nicer API for the
sake of range-for looping; but point() is more suited to being
non-const.
In QML it's expected to be OK to emit a signal with a QPointerEvent
by value: that will involve copying the event. But QEventPoint
instances are explicitly shared, so calling setAccepted() modifies
the instance in activePoints (EventPointData.eventPoint.d->accept);
and the grabbers are stored separately and thus preserved between events.
In code such as MouseArea { onPressed: mouse.accepted = false }
we can either continue to emit the QQuickMouseEvent wrapper
or perhaps QEvent::setAccepted() could become virtual and set
the eventpoint's accepted flag instead, so that it will survive
after the event copy that QML sees is discarded.
The grabChanged() signal is useful to keep QQuickWindow informed
when items or handlers change exclusive or passive grabbers.
When a release happens at a different location than the last move event,
Qt synthesizes an additional move. But it would be "boring" if
QEventPoint::lastXPosition() accessors in any released eventpoint always
returned the same as the current QEventPoint::xPosition()s just because
of that; and it would mean that the velocity() must always be zero on
release, which would make it hard to use the final velocity to drive an
animation. So now we expect the lastPositions to be different than
current positions in a released eventpoint.
De-inline some functions whose implementations might be subject to
change later on. Improve documentation.
Since we have an accessor for pressTimestamp(), we might as well add one for
timestamp() too. That way users get enough information to calculate
instantaneous velocity, since the plan is for velocity() to be somewhat
smoothed.
